key goals
high performance: designed for speed, with performance rivaling Rust & C
expressiveness: write concise, clean & clear code for everything from web development to systems programming
safety & ergonomics: statically-typed with encouraged type inference & robust error handling
write once, run anywhere: build reliable software for any platform (or none at all) with a friendly std library
why yttria?
yittria (/ˈjɪtʃ.ri.ə/, pronounced yi-tch-ria) is a fast, expressive language that lets you build anything from scripts to systems.
It combines the performance of C with the expressiveness of Typescript, making it ideal for both beginners and experienced developers.
Whether you're building web apps, games, or low-level systems, yttria has you covered.

getting started
to get started with yttria, you can use the cli tool.
# install the yttria cli tool
...
# create a new yttria project
yt init
# run your yttria program
yt run .
# build your yttria program
yt build .
features
yttria includes a wide range of features to help you build robust applications:
- statically typed with type inference
- powerful pattern matching for concise data handling
- macros for metaprogramming and code generation
- async/await for easy concurrency
- first-class functions and closures (functions inside functions) for functional programming
- extensive standard library for common tasks
- robust error handling with
try/catchandResulttypes - cross-platform support for building applications on any platform
- and much more!
